"""The tests for the Ring switch platform.""" from unittest.mock import PropertyMock import pytest import ring_doorbell from homeassistant.config_entries import SOURCE_REAUTH from homeassistant.const import Platform from homeassistant.core import HomeAssistant from homeassistant.exceptions import HomeAssistantError from homeassistant.helpers import entity_registry as er from .common import setup_platform async def test_entity_registry( hass: HomeAssistant, entity_registry: er.EntityRegistry, mock_ring_client, ) -> None: """Tests that the devices are registered in the entity registry.""" await setup_platform(hass, Platform.CAMERA) entry = entity_registry.async_get("camera.front") assert entry.unique_id == "765432" entry = entity_registry.async_get("camera.internal") assert entry.unique_id == "345678" @pytest.mark.parametrize( ("entity_name", "expected_state", "friendly_name"), [ ("camera.internal", True, "Internal"), ("camera.front", None, "Front"), ], ids=["On", "Off"], ) async def test_camera_motion_detection_state_reports_correctly( hass: HomeAssistant, mock_ring_client, entity_name, expected_state, friendly_name, ) -> None: """Tests that the initial state of a device that should be off is correct.""" await setup_platform(hass, Platform.CAMERA) state = hass.states.get(entity_name) assert state.attributes.get("motion_detection") is expected_state assert state.attributes.get("friendly_name") == friendly_name async def test_camera_motion_detection_can_be_turned_on( hass: HomeAssistant, mock_ring_client ) -> None: """Tests the siren turns on correctly.""" await setup_platform(hass, Platform.CAMERA) state = hass.states.get("camera.front") assert state.attributes.get("motion_detection") is not True await hass.services.async_call( "camera", "enable_motion_detection", {"entity_id": "camera.front"}, blocking=True, ) await hass.async_block_till_done() state = hass.states.get("camera.front") assert state.attributes.get("motion_detection") is True async def test_updates_work( hass: HomeAssistant, mock_ring_client, mock_ring_devices ) -> None: """Tests the update service works correctly.""" await setup_platform(hass, Platform.CAMERA) state = hass.states.get("camera.internal") assert state.attributes.get("motion_detection") is True internal_camera_mock = mock_ring_devices.get_device(345678) internal_camera_mock.motion_detection = False await hass.services.async_call("ring", "update", {}, blocking=True) await hass.async_block_till_done() state = hass.states.get("camera.internal") assert state.attributes.get("motion_detection") is not True @pytest.mark.parametrize( ("exception_type", "reauth_expected"), [ (ring_doorbell.AuthenticationError, True), (ring_doorbell.RingTimeout, False), (ring_doorbell.RingError, False), ], ids=["Authentication", "Timeout", "Other"], ) async def test_motion_detection_errors_when_turned_on( hass: HomeAssistant, mock_ring_client, mock_ring_devices, exception_type, reauth_expected, ) -> None: """Tests the motion detection errors are handled correctly.""" await setup_platform(hass, Platform.CAMERA) config_entry = hass.config_entries.async_entries("ring")[0] assert not any(config_entry.async_get_active_flows(hass, {SOURCE_REAUTH})) front_camera_mock = mock_ring_devices.get_device(765432) p = PropertyMock(side_effect=exception_type) type(front_camera_mock).motion_detection = p with pytest.raises(HomeAssistantError): await hass.services.async_call( "camera", "enable_motion_detection", {"entity_id": "camera.front"}, blocking=True, ) await hass.async_block_till_done() p.assert_called_once() assert ( any( flow for flow in config_entry.async_get_active_flows(hass, {SOURCE_REAUTH}) if flow["handler"] == "ring" ) == reauth_expected )
